Visualizzazione dei risultati da 1 a 3 su 3
  1. #1

    [java] usare funzioni di altre classi

    ciao,


    uff... ho all interno dello stesso package due classi pubbliche classe_A, classe_B.

    sulla classe_A c'è una funzione pubblica funzione_A e mi piacerebbe tanto usarla sulla classe_B.

    come posso fare?

    pensavo che scrivendo solo

    "package nome_package;"

    bastasse per ottenere la visibilità... invece no.

  2. #2
    la dichiarazione di import del package è inutile se sono sullo stesso.
    Se il metodo (in OO si parla di metodi e non di funzioni/procedure) è statico lo puoi invocare come:

    codice:
    nomeClasse.nomeMetodo(parametri)
    se invece non è statico ti devi creare prima un'istanza della classe (oggetto) su cui invocare il metodo:

    codice:
    nomeClasse obj = new nomeClasse(parametri);
    obj.nomeMetodo(parametri)
    ma visti questi dubbi proprio di base, ti consiglio caldamente di ristudiare le basi del linguaggio!
    In bocca al lupo!
    Ivan Venuti
    Vuoi scaricare alcuni articoli sulla programmazione, pubblicati su riviste di informatica? Visita http://ivenuti.altervista.org/articoli.htm. Se vuoi imparare JavaScript leggi il mio libro: http://www.fag.it/scheda.aspx?ID=21754 !

  3. #3
    ma visti questi dubbi proprio di base, ti consiglio caldamente di ristudiare le basi del linguaggio!
    In bocca al lupo!
    ..e c'hai ragggggioone!!!


    grazie

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.